Abstract

The concentration of particulate matter (PM), SO2, NOx, SO3, HCl, HF, and PM2.5 were measured in a 330MW ultra low emission coal-fired power unit. The pollutants emission characteristics and the effect of the conventional pollution control devices on non-conventional pollutants were investigated. The test results show that the concentration of NOx, SO2 and PM are 26.9 mg/m3, 18.1 mg/m3, 2.9 mg/m3 respectively. The coal-fired power plant, equipped with WFGD and WESP could well control SO3, HCl, HF, and PM2.5 emission from the flue gas. SO3 removal efficiency of WFGD and WESP are 42.2% and 82.8% respectively. HCl and HF removal efficiency by WFGD are 90.8% and 91.5% respectively. PM2.5 removal efficiency of WESP is 86.9%.
